If you need to, there is an option to block another user from interacting with your content. You can, however, use the app to edit the photo but choose to SKIP the publishing portion. Users don’t have the option to make their accounts private, so anyone can see the photos they share. NOTE: Even if you do not allow LOCATION during account set-up you still need to manually adjust your location settings under SETTINGS>PRIVACY CONTACTS (to connect with people you already know).LOCATION (to include location tag for published photos).NOTIFICATIONS (to be notified when your content is recognized by the community).After creating and verifying an account they ask you to grant access to: VSCO allows you to sign up with Facebook, Google, phone number or email. Similarly to favorites, your follower count is not publicly displayed. VSCO will suggest people to follow by syncing your contacts or by similar editing/posting styles. Only you can see who favorited your image.Īdditionally, you can “follow” other users. Favorites is a way to react to photos on VSCO but the reaction stays between the two of you. You can, however, privately favorite posts you like on VSCO. This is even part of the app description: “Because beautiful imagery trumps social clout, the number of followers, comments, and likes are absent from the platform”. They want the emphasis on great looking photos and not how many likes or comments you can get. There are no “likes” or commenting on photos. Because of this, many user VSCO to share their more artistic photos and practice their photography skills.Ī key difference between VSCO and Instagram is that there is limited social interaction. The company defines itself as an art and technology company and promotes their more “serious” editing features than Instagram has. VSCO provides a direct option to share your photo to Instagram, Instagram stories, Snap, or to the copy the link and share elsewhere. Similar to Instagram, VSCO allows users to edit and add filters to photos in order to share or save.
